The garage occupancy feed for the Brindlewood campus arrives over a message queue every thirty seconds, one record per level, published by the Stallgrid edge boxes. Counts can briefly go negative when a sensor double-fires on exit; the ingest job clamps these to zero and flags the interval. If the feed stalls for more than five minutes, the dashboard falls back to the last known snapshot. Sensor mappings, queue names, and the replay procedure are documented on the internal page below.

runbook for tahog-kadug: https://gitlab.qirvanworks.corp/projects/pages/view/b139298aed28

**Q: What happens when the Skerrybridge upstream API trips the circuit breaker?**

When the breaker opens, plugin calls receive a fast-fail response with a retry-after hint instead of hanging. Your plugin should honor that hint and serve cached data where possible. The breaker re-probes automatically; do not implement your own retry storm. Configuration options and state diagrams are documented here.

wiki page, tahaf-tajog: https://jira.ordindyn.corp/pipeline

If the sqlward lint account for the Bramblewick release line is locked, do not bypass linting—unchecked SQL migrations have caused outages before. As release manager, open the Oakmere recovery console, select the lint-bot account, and verify the last successful run timestamp matches the changelog. Once verified, proceed to credential restore, which requires entering the recovery passphrase that appears below.

unlock words, hahip-baduf: holwyn-istath-julvan